Mr. Smiley, since your thread HAS ALREADY been hijacked, I can assure you that a bamboo, v. lion, ray and eel will all live happily in a 180 for some time. I have this exact combination in my 125. My rays are Calis and my eel is a zebra. Be cautioned, however, about how you feed the lion and ray. My ray comes to the surface as does the lion. By accident my male ray took a "quill" on the side of his mouth underneath his eye. To resolve this, I fed the lion first on the opposite side of the tank then dropped the food to the rays. Get them all conditioned to a feeding order to avoid problems. Hope youre still reading the thread.
